Description
Hello, we are Milena and Emilio, 38 and 43 years old. We live in a very beautiful land, in Castelluzzo, near Trapani, sicilian west coast. We have mostly olive trees, vegetable garden, and officinal plants and we produce olive oil for our own consumption.
Right now we are bulding our house, after several years of awful beaureaucratic waiting! So, it's a great end epic moment for us. Our house will be entirely in straw and wood so if you will come you will enjoy and learn the different steps of a green building site. We will offer workshops open to everyone to learn eco-building, so it will be a very lively and exciting building site!
So we need help for it and also babysitting with our kids (one of 9 and half years old, and one 3 years old), with house maintenance, cleaning, washing, cooking (so we request also cooking skills) and also gardening, like farming jobs that request a good energy and strenght (mulch, bio-shredding , uprooting...).
Our area: we are not isolated, in these last 4 years we built a big community of friends of all ages. 2 years ago we created a parental school where our eldest son go and where we teach sometimes. If you are looking for places with a strong community, here we are. We cook the bread together in the wood-fired oven once a month (or pizza) we organize always parties, lunchs, dinners...
We live in a small house, nearby we have a yurta tent that is a shared space when you can read, rest, cook, work on your laptop or anything. You will be host in a wood house near the yurta, comfortable and private. You will have also your private bathroom with shower, outside the wood house.
We usually cook together or sometimes we provide for your food and you can cook in the yurta by yourself.
We offer a very beautiful landscape to have a walk or do trekking in the free time, a wonderful sea, the best place to practice climbing, swimming and reconnect yourself with nature.

Cultural exchange and learning opportunities
You will learn the basic permaculture practices, like bio-shredding, preserving the wood for the winter, mulch to protect the plants from heat. Also we need people who help us with general maintenance. We are artists, we work with the cinema and we like to play the guitar and sing, so we often organize little concerts in the yurta with friends of our community.

Help
We are at the beginning of our permaculture and medicinal herbs farm, so there are a lot of priorities. We just produce olive oil for our consumption, we still aren't a business activity, so we can't offer a monetary payment. In autumn we need help to pick the olives and bring them the crusher. In summer, we need creative and propositive people, who can help us also with farm design, socials, disposal of pruning, etc. Animals are not welcome, not yet because plants are still smalls. We don't have internet wi-fi, and we use the water well to cook, wash, shower and water the plants, so we require to not waste it, because during the summer it rarely rains.
